M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] DAB2IP is a Ras (MIM 190020) GTPase-activating protein (GAP) that acts as a tumor suppressor. The DAB2IP gene is inactivated by methylation in prostate and breast cancers (Yano et al., 2005 [PubMed 15386433]).[supplied by OMIM, May 2010]
PHENOTYPE: Mice homozygous for a knock-out allele exhibit impaired IRE1-mediated endoplasmic reticulum (ER) stress-induced responses. Mice homozygous for a gene trap allele exhibit delayed Purkinje cell dendritogenesis. [provided by MGI curators]
